浙江大学数字电路实验指导讲义(第二版):PLD与VHDL设计详解

需积分: 9 1 下载量 195 浏览量 更新于2024-07-24 收藏 6.14MB PDF 举报
《20110310-数字电路实验指导讲义(第二版)》是由浙江大学电工电子基础实验中心的樊伟敏和祁才君编撰于2011年3月的一份重要教材。该讲义主要针对数字电路实验教学,涵盖了可编程逻辑器件(PLD)的基础知识和VHDL语言的深入讲解。 第一部分介绍了PLD的概述,包括不同类型的PLD如低成本的Cyclone FPGA系列(如Cyclone II和Cyclone III),中端的Arria FPGA系列,高端的Stratix FPGA系列,以及MAX CPLD系列和HardCopy ASIC系列。详细讲述了Cyclone III的内部结构和配置过程,强调了其在实验中的实际应用。 第二章是VHDL语言基础,VHDL是Verilog Hardware Description Language的缩写,是一种用于描述数字系统行为的高级硬件描述语言。这部分内容包括VHDL程序的基本结构,如实体(Entity)、结构体(Architecture)的定义和使用,以及包集合(Package)的概念。还详细解释了VHDL语言的关键元素,如基本词法单元、关键字、数据对象、数据类型、转换、限定、属性、运算操作符等,并区分了顺序语句和并发语句。 第三部分深入探讨了数字电路基本模块的VHDL设计方法,包括组合电路和时序电路的设计。组合电路部分讲解了基本门电路、三人表决器、数据选择器、译码器、编码器、三态门、奇偶校验电路和比较器的设计。时序电路部分则涉及JK触发器、移位寄存器、序列脉冲发生器、计数器、分频器、锁存器和只读存储器等常见电路的VHDL实现。 这份讲义为学生提供了全面的数字电路实验指导,不仅涵盖了PLD的基本原理和设计流程,而且深入浅出地介绍了VHDL语言的使用技巧,对于理解和设计复杂的数字电路系统具有极高的实用价值。无论是初学者还是进阶者,都能从中找到适合自己的学习资料和实践案例。